Obverse description Left-facing bust of H.R.H. Edward, Prince of Wales, wearing a coronet and ermine-trimmed robes, in high relief. The surrounding legend reads INVESTITURE OF EDWARD PRINCE OF WALES K.G., with the date and location inscription CARN- IVLY XIII / ARVON MCMXI divided across the field on either side of the effigy.
